Biochem/physiol Actions
N-Methyl amino acids play an important role in investigations on prevention or therapy of Alzheimer′s disease, neurofibrillary tangles or amyloid plaque are physiological characteristics of this disease and ?-amyloid(40) fibrillogenesis and disassembly of ?-amyloid(40) fibrils is inhibited by short ?-amyloid congeners containing N-methyl amino acids at alternate residue.
